Kidney Pathology I.<br />

Anatomy. Clinical syndromes. Glomerula diseaeses. Renal disease and<br />

systemic disorders. Congenital abnormalities. Inflammatory and<br />

non-inflammatory lesions.<br />

Kidney Pathology II.<br />

Tubulointerstitial diseases. Hydronephrosis. Lithiasis.<br />

Kidney Pathology III.<br />

Tumors of the kidney. Kidney transplantation.<br />

Uropathology<br />

Congenital abnormalities of the urinary tract. Inflammations. Urinary bladder<br />

(malformations, inflammations, tumors). Urethra<br />

Male genital system<br />

Diseases of the epididymis, testis, prostate, penis<br />

and scrotum.<br />

Gynecologic pathology I<br />

Precancerous lesions of the cervix. Cervix carcinoma. Endometrial hyperplasias.<br />

Benign and malignant tumors of the endometrium.<br />

Gynecologic pathology II.<br />

Inflammations of the vulva, vagina and uterus. Tumors of the vulva, vagina and<br />

uterus. Pathology of the fallopian tubes. Normal menstrual cycle. Bleeding<br />

abnormalities. Pathology of pregnancy. Ovarial diseases.<br />

Neonatology - Pediatric tumors.<br />

Premature birth and its complications. Intrauterine infections and their<br />

consequences. Twin pregnancy. Diseases of the perinatal period. Sudden infant<br />

death. Pediatric Tumors – pathology and diagnosis of pediatric malignancies.<br />

Breast I<br />

Symptoms and diagnosis of breast diseases.<br />

Malformations. Benign symptomatic lesions (inflammations, fibrocystic disease,<br />

epithelial dysplasia and its significance, benign tumors)<br />

Breast II<br />

Malignant tumors - epidemiology, risk factors.<br />

Histologic types of breast carcinoma. Prognostic factors in breast cancer<br />

Non-epithelial breast malignancies<br />

Screening: non-palpable breast lesions<br />

The male breast.<br />

Blood and lymphoid organs I.<br />

Hemopoetic system. Normal function (bone marrow, lymph nodes, spleen).<br />

Morphology and immunologic evaluation. Disorders of platelets and<br />

coagulation. Anemias, polycytemia. Neutrophilia. Proliferative disorders of mast<br />

cells. Monocytosis. Sinus histiocytosis. Benign disorders of lymphoid cells.<br />

Blood and lymphoid organs II.<br />

Acute myeloproliferative syndromes (acute leukaemias). Chronic<br />

myeloproliferative syndromes (CML, myelofibrosis, thrombocytemia). Acute and<br />

chronic lymphocytic leukaemias. Disorders of the spleen.<br />

Blood and lymphoid organs III.<br />

Lymphomas (Hodgkin, non-Hodgkin). Metastatic tumors in bone marrow and<br />

lymph nodes. Clinicopathological case demonstrations.<br />

Nervous system I.<br />

Trauma, vascular and circulatory disorders. CSF dynamics. Enchepahlomyelitis,<br />

meningitis. Congenital malformations. Metabolic storage.
